parking so you can be fully prepared for your trip. There is indeed a shuttle that runs from the Toy Story parking lot to the parks so you won't need to worry about walking. Additionally, if you choose to park in the Mickey & Friends parking structure, there is a tram that will whisk you to the parks. Both parking areas are accessible by foot if you prefer to get a little exercise in before your fun day at the Disneyland Resort.
You can
purchase your parking vouchers in advance online to save you some time. Also, keep in mind that you can come and go and only pay for parking once per day. This is extremely helpful if you are traveling with little ones that might need to head back to the hotel for a nap in the middle of day. Just make sure to keep your parking receipt to show the parking attendant upon re-entry.
Finally, if you will be enjoying a meal at any of the
Disneyland Resort Hotels, you can park for up to three hours free at the hotels with validation. If you happen to be dining at Napa Rose or enjoying a spa treatment at Mandara Spa, both located inside Disney's Grand Californian Hotel and Spa, then you can park for free at the hotel for up to five hours.
